Konvertering av Excel-filer til PDF er et vanlig krav i mange bransjer, hvor data deling og presentasjon kvalitet er avgjørende. Aspose.Cells for .NET gir en effektiv måte å konvertere Excel spreadsheets til høykvalitets PDF-dokumenter samtidig som opprettholde den opprinnelige layouten og formatingen.
Introduction
Konvertering av Excel-filer til PDF er viktig i mange bransjer hvor data deling og presentasjon kvalitet er nøkkelen. Aspose.Cells for .NET lar deg konvertere Excel filer til høykvalitets PDF-er, beholde layout og formatering, og sikre sømløs dokumenthåndtering.
Fordelene med Excel til PDF konvertering
Layout bevaring:- Konverter Excel spreadsheets til PDF-er samtidig som de opprettholder sin opprinnelige formatering.
** Forbedret tilgjengelighet** :- PDF-er er enklere å dele og se i forhold til Excel-filer, noe som gjør dataene dine mer tilgjengelige.
*Data integritet *:- Sørg for at ingen data blir tapt eller endret under konverteringsprosessen, og holde informasjonen din intakt.
Step-by-step guide for å konvertere Excel til PDF i .NET
Steg 1: Installere Aspose.Cells for .NET
Installere Aspose.Cells-biblioteket fra NuGet Package Manager for å legge til Excel til PDF-konversjonskapasitet til .NET eller C#-prosjektet ditt.
Install-Package Aspose.Cells
Steg 2: Sett opp lisensnøkler
Sett din lisens eller målte nøkler for Aspose.Cells bibliotek for å få tilgang til det fulle utvalget av konverteringsfunksjoner.
using Aspose.Cells;
Metered license = new Metered();
license.SetMeteredKey("<your public key>", "<your private key>");
Console.WriteLine("Metered license configured successfully.");
Trinn 3: Last ned Excel-filen
Last ned Excel-filen ved hjelp av Workbook-klassen. Dette gjelder for .xlsx eller templatefiler.
string inputPath = @"C:\path\to\your\file.xlsx";
Workbook workbook = new Workbook(inputPath);
Console.WriteLine("Excel file loaded successfully.");
Steg 4: Lagre Excel-filen som PDF
Bruk Workbook.Save-metoden for å lagre filen som et PDF-dokument med høy troverdighet, slik at layout og formatering bevares.
string outputPath = @"C:\path\to\output\file.pdf";
workbook.Save(outputPath, SaveFormat.PDF);
Console.WriteLine($"Excel file saved as PDF at: {outputPath}");
Steg 5: Test utgangen PDF
Etter å ha konvertert filen, åpne den resulterende PDF-filen for å verifisere at layout og formatering matcher det opprinnelige Excel-dokumentet.
Steg 6: Integrere PDF konverteringsfunksjonalitet
Integrere Excel til PDF-konversjonskoden i .NET-applikasjonen din. Dette fungerer for C#, VB.NET, WinForms og ASP.Net-prosjekter.
Steg 7: Oppsett for automatisk Excel til PDF konvertering
Oppsett løsningen for batchbehandling eller automatisk konvertering av Excel-filer til PDF ved hjelp av din nye funksjonalitet.
Vanlige problemer og fixer
1 Formatering av problemstillinger
- Løsning : Sørg for at Excel-filen ikke inneholder ustøttet formatering eller korrupte celler som kan forårsake konverteringsfeil.
2. feil utgangsvei
- Løsning : Double-check at utgangsdiagrammet eksisterer og har skriftlige tillatelser for å unngå sparingsfeil.
Slått konvertering for store filer
- Løsning : Tenk å bryte store Excel-filer inn i mindre filer for raskere konvertering eller optimalisere Excel arbeidsboken for ytelse.
Vanlige spørsmål (FAQ)
Hvordan konvertere Excel til PDF i C#?
Bruk Aspose.Cells for .NET for å laste opp Excel-filen med arbeidsbokklassen og ringe Save-metoden med SaveFormat.PDF.
Kan jeg bruke Aspose.Cells til å konvertere XLSX til PDF i .NET Core?
Ja, Aspose.Cells støtter .NET Core, .Net Framework og ASP.NET for Excel til PDF konvertering.
Hvordan opprettholde formatering når du konverterer Excel til PDF?
Aspose.Cells beholder layout og formatering som standard.For spesielle krav, tilpasse PDF-lagring alternativer.
Er batch Excel til PDF konvertering mulig i C#?
Ja, gå gjennom flere filer og bruk Workbook.Save for å konvertere hver Excel-fil til PDF.
Kan jeg konvertere Excel til PDF i VB.NET?
Ja, det samme kodemønsteret fungerer for både C# og VB.NET med små syntaxendringer.